SPANS

The spanning capability of Stramit® Fascia shown has been determined by testing (in accordance with AS4040.1) for a combination of roof tile and foot traffic loads. The maximum spacing of Stramit® Fascia rafter brackets is:

Where a separate tilt/roof batten is fitted adjacent to the fascia:

  • internal spans 1500
  • end spans 1200 maximum (200 minimum)

Note that for a jack rafter to be considered as a support position it must be adequately connected to the hip rafter.

Where the fascia is used as the tilt batten:

  • internal spans 1200
  • end spans 900

PRESSURES

The wind resistance of Stramit® Fascia has then been determined at these spans by testing in accordance with AS4040.2 – and for each of the spans is suitable for use in areas of up to: 0.92 kPa SERVICEABILITY LIMIT-STATE, 2.25 kPa STRENGTH LIMIT-STATE. These pressures are equivalent to: N3 (Region A – rural, Region B – exposed suburban).
